Methods : Taking clean KM 70 male mice were randomly divided into 7 groups, namely saline group, ringworm cream group, matrix groups, large doses of ginkgo alcohol paste group, low-dose ginkgo group alcohol paste, paste large dose of ginkgo water group, low-dose ginkgo water paste group. Large and small doses of alcohol ginkgo group and paste large and small doses of ginkgo water paste group of animals were painted on both sides of the right ear of the appropriate medication altogether 0. 05 mL (0.03 g/ear, 0.015 g/ear), ringworm ringworm cream smear group Salve (0.03 g/ear), an ointment is administered a thickness of 0. 02 mm; saline 0. 9% sodium chloride injection smear 0. 05mL, xylene painting by mouse ear swelling copy mouse ear model was ginkgo paste Effect of topical agents on ear swelling in mice;take 70 male Wistar rats were randomly divided into 7 groups uniform, normal saline group, ringworm cream group, matrix groups,large doses of ginkgo group alcohol paste, paste a small dose of ginkgo alcohol agent group, large doses of ginkgo water paste group, low-dose ginkgo water paste group. Large and small doses of alcohol ginkgo group and paste large and small doses of ginkgo water paste right hind paw of each group are wrapped with two layers of gauze and the corresponding liquid adsorption 0.5 mL(0.3 g/foot,0.15 g/foot), ringworm cream ringworm cream to group (0.30 g/foot), saline group was given 0.9% sodium chloride injection 0.5 mL, subcutaneous injection of fresh liquid egg white rat paw edema model in rats copy, paste external observation ginkgo inflammatory inhibition.
